Antonio Brown knows which NFL team he wants to play for next season. While appearing on the I Am Athlete podcast, Brown, who was released by the Tampa Bay Buccaneers earlier this month, said he would love to play for the Baltimore Ravens. Brown was asked which quarterback was “next in line” in his career.

“Lamar Jackson,” Brown said on the podcast hosted by former NFL wide receiver Brandon Marshall, who asked if that’s the QB he wants to play for. “Jackson action,” Brown said. Let’s give Lamar Jackson his flowers… Shout out to Lamar Jackson. That’s it. Lamar Jackson is a great quarterback. Not just him throwing the ball, the dynamics of his game, the emotion.”

Jackson saw the video of Brown talking about joining the Ravens and took to Twitter to retweet it on his page while posting a smiley face emoji with horns. This isn’t the first time Brown has talked about playing for the Ravens. As The Baltimore Sun mentioned, Brown trained with Jackson and his cousin Marquise Brown, who plays for Baltimore. Video of the workout surfaced in April 2020, and at the time, Jackson was asked about the possibility of the team signing Antonio Brown.

“I’d be happy if they signed him,” Jackson said of Brown, who was between teams after being eliminated by the New England Patriots in September 2019. “He’s a great player. He showed it every year when he played.” He was with the Steelers in the past, but it’s not my decision.” Brown signed with the Buccaneers later that year and helped the team win a Super Bowl. He re-signed with the team before the 2021 season and finished his season with 42 receptions, 545 yards, and four touchdowns in seven games. He was released by the Bucs before the regular season ended after he left the field during the team’s game against the New York Jets.

The Ravens finished the 2021 season with an 8โ€“9 record, their first losing season since 2015. They also missed the playoffs for the first time since 2017, but the team was without Jackson for five games due to injury. The Ravens had two record 1,000-yard receivers. Marquise Brown caught 91 passes for 1,008 yards and six touchdowns, and tight end Mark Andrews caught 107 passes for 1,361 yards and nine touchdowns.
